- EUR/USD hits new short-term trend high, May 22 high & 61.8 Fib of 1.1468-1.0819 cleared
- German 10 year yield rallies to 0.83%, seen as the main driver behind
- Next decent resistance near 1.1315/25 (76.4 Fib & May 19 high)
- Sub-1.1075/80 needed to ease immediate bull pressure
- RSIs are biased up with room to run, suggests more gains due
- Large offers noted 1.1240
